In this blog, we explain:
- What this message really means
- Why your webhook is not receiving real messages
- How to fix it step by step
- What Anjok Technologies does to resolve it

💡 What Does This Message Mean (Simple Explanation)?
Simple words 👇
When your Meta app is UNPUBLISHED:
- ✅ You will receive only test webhooks
- ❌ You will NOT receive real WhatsApp messages
- ❌ Even admin / developer messages won’t come
- ❌ No production data is sent to your webhook
This restriction is enforced by Meta Platforms.
🧪 What Are “Test Webhooks”?
Test webhooks are:
- Fake / sample events
- Sent manually from Meta Dashboard
- Used only to test webhook URL & response
They help you verify:
✔ Webhook URL is reachable
✔ Verification token works
✔ Server responds correctly
But they are NOT real WhatsApp messages.
❌ Why Real WhatsApp Messages Are Not Coming
This is the most common confusion.
Even if:
- You are app admin
- You sent message from same number
- Webhook verification is successful
👉 You will NOT receive real messages
👉 Until the app is PUBLISHED
This is expected behavior.
🔑 Key Rule You Must Remember
Unpublished App = Test Webhooks Only
Published App = Real WhatsApp Messages
There is no workaround for this.
✅ How to Fix This Issue (Step-by-Step)
STEP 1: Make Sure Your App Is Ready
Before publishing, ensure:
- Webhook verification is successful
- HTTPS webhook URL
- No PHP / server errors
- WhatsApp product added
STEP 2: Check Required Permissions
Your app should request ONLY:
- whatsapp_business_messaging
- whatsapp_business_management
Extra permissions = possible rejection.
STEP 3: Complete App Review (If Required)
In most WhatsApp Cloud API cases:
- App review is minimal
- Clear use-case explanation is enough
Explain:
“We use WhatsApp Cloud API to send and receive customer support and transactional messages for opted-in users.”
STEP 4: Publish the App 🚀
- Go to Meta Developer Dashboard
- Open your App
- Click Publish App
- Confirm publishing
Once published:
✅ Webhooks receive real WhatsApp messages
✅ Admin & tester messages work
✅ Production traffic starts


🧠 Very Important Notes (Avoid Confusion)
- Publishing app ≠ making it public on App Store
- Publishing means allowing production data
- Your app is still private to your business
- Only WhatsApp API is affected
❓ Common Developer Questions
❓ Will admin messages work before publishing?
❌ No. Even admin messages are blocked.
❓ Can I use test number instead?
❌ Test number works only for testing.
❓ Is this a webhook bug?
❌ No. This is Meta policy.
🏢 How Anjok Technologies Helps
Anjok Technologies helps developers and businesses with:
✔ WhatsApp Cloud API setup
✔ Webhook configuration
✔ App publishing & permissions
✔ App review explanation writing
✔ Fixing “no webhook data” issues
✔ Production-ready WhatsApp systems
Most webhook issues are solved within minutes once app is published.
📞 Contact Anjok Technologies
📱 +91 80729 70517
🌐 anjoktechnologies.in
👉 Ask for WhatsApp API Webhook & App Publish Support